Join us in this video episode of the Obehi Podcast, where we sit down with Chris Obehi. As a compelling Afrobeat musician, Chris shares his unique perspective on music and cultural influence. He argues that the powerful spirit of Fela Kuti continues to inspire and shape today’s sound.
This conversation offers insights into how artists, like leaders, can build a brand that resonates deeply. It’s about connecting with your roots and making them relevant for a new generation.
